Max Cavender

Home club – Milwaukee Lake Park LBC

When and where did you first start bowling?
August 2004 in Milwaukee

What do you like about lawn bowling? What keeps you coming back?
It’s a combination of the great people I have met and continue to meet, at home and around the U.S., and the great level of competition that the game provides, in addition to its strategy and amount of mental strength required.

What brand and model of bowls do you use?
a. 10-12 second green: Henselite Classic (standard bias)
b. 14-16 second green: preferably Taylor Ace

What size lawn bowls do you use?
Anywhere from a size 5 to a size 7.

How many sets of bowls do you presently own?
I don’t actually own any bowls. I either use one of around 8-10 sets that my Dad owns, or a set that my dad’s friend lets me use. If I had enough money I might buy a set of Taylor Aces, preferably colored.

What type of grip do you use? (finger-tip, claw, palm, other)
I just put the bowl in my hand with my thumb on the dimple/line on the side , and don’t cup the bowl ever unless it’s raining or conditions are extremely damp and the bowls are too wet

How do you initially select your line? (point on bank, spot on green, shoulder-arc of bowl, overall visualization of green, other)
I like to be really dynamic and just go with whatever works.  But normally I just pick out a spot on the green, and once you’ve rolled enough bowls it just kind of comes to you.

What game do you prefer to play and why? (i.e. singles-pairs-triples-fours)
I like aspects of all of them – singles because you rely on yourself and have nobody to blame but yourself, pairs because of camaraderie among you and one other player, and the team games because it forces you to focus even more and become a more complete player.

What is your goal during trial ends?
Just getting a feel for pace and line, it’s always nice to start out with both going well and maintain it, but sometimes it’s a struggle and that’s just the way bowls is.

In singles, do you usually take the mat or give it away?
I let my opponent determine that. If they are killing me with their last bowl, then I take the the last bowl.  But if they are really feeling a certain length I’ll take the mat and change it  up.

In a clutch situation, are you more likely to draw or drive? (assuming both shots could work)
That’s really tough; if I knew the answer to that I would be really dangerous on the green.  But honestly, there are so many variables, I just make a decision and go with it. I always try to know what I’m going to do before I step on the mat.

What one rule of the game would you like to see changed?
I would like to see a system that assigns a range of bias’ one can use on a given green according to its speed. I think narrow bowls have taken away from the tradition of the game.
